This document contains questions for an exam on linear integrated circuits. It covers various topics like advantages of integrated circuits over discrete components, slew rate, common mode rejection ratio, offset voltage of operational amplifiers, voltage followers, current mirrors, phase shift circuits, limitations of ideal integrators, comparators, lock-in range and capture range of phase locked loops. The questions are divided into three parts - Part A contains 10 short answer questions, Part B contains 5 long answer questions to be answered from choices, Part C contains 1 long answer question to be answered from choices.
